Students at William Dandy Middle School score 29% proficient, which is below what's typical for similar communities (expected: 44%).

About William Dandy Middle School

William Dandy Middle School is a public middle school in Fort Lauderdale, FL, part of Broward, serving approximately 681 students in grades 6th-8th with a 17.5: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 3.2 out of 10 and ranks #3,665 of 3,778 schools in FL. State assessment records show 43%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024) and 42%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024).
